OPERATION

TOOL ATTACHMENT

WARNING:

Never pull cable to device to be retracted. Always lift object to hook. If the hook is
accidentally released when it is extended, it will snap back. Hazards or unsafe practices
which COULD result in severe
personal injury or death.

Balancer is furnished with a tool clip. Attach tool complete with hose or cable along fittings. To adjust
length of overhang, remove all tension. Pull cable down and position hook at desired height. Loosen
cable stop, slide cable stop upward to roller guide, and tighten. Move cable stop upward and lengthen
overhang of cable will reduce active travel distance. For every foot more of overhang, the active travel
will be reduced by a foot.

Overhang can be adjusted by moving cable stop. If it is determined that the overhang is not sufficient, an

optional overhang extension cable can be used to increase overhang without reducing active travel.

SPRING TENSIONING

NOTE: Attach full load including all attachments before adjusting tension.

If weight of tool exceeds amount of existing tension of balancer mainspring, cable will descend. Increase
tension of mainspring by applying a wrench to flats on mainspring shaft and rotate counter-clockwise until
proper tension is reached and load begins to retract. Tool will move upward if tension exceeds the load.

Decrease tension by applying a wrench to the flats on mainspring shaft and HOLD. Release tension of
mainshaft by squeezing together spring lever slowly on opposite side of reel. Rotate wrench clock wise
until proper tension is reached and load descends properly.

After adjusting tension, pull cable to fullest extension to ensure proper travel is achieved. If cable does
not reach full extension, some tension must be released. If proper tension and extension cannot be
achieved, consult the factory.

RATCHET LOCK (FOR 10FLR & 15FLR ONLY)

The ratchet lock works in two positions in one complete rotation. Pull cable to desired location and let
cable retract slightly until lock engages, much like a window shade. To release lock, pull cable out
slightly.

For constant tension, ratchet lock may be disengaged. Turn lock release knob counter-clock wise while
pulling cable in and out slightly to engage lock release lever.

CABLE STOP ADJUSTMENT

NOTE: Moving the cable stop will reduce the active travel distance. If additional cable extension is required,

extension cable assemblies are offered as an accessory.

Cable stop can be moved up along the cable to attain the most desirable working height.

SERVICE

MAINSPRING REPLACEMENT

WARNING:

Spring is dangerous. Before removing broken spring, weld coils together at four (4)
locations or wrap securely with wire. Failure to secure spring leads hazards or unsafe
practices which COULD result in severe
personal injury or death.

CAUTION:

Remove all tension before servicing. Hazards or unsafe practices MAY result in minor
personal injury or product or property damage.

Remove all tension by applying a wrench to flats on mainspring shaft
and HOLD. Release tension of mainshaft by squeezing together
spring lever slowly on opposite side of reel. Then rotate wrench
clock- wise until proper tension is reached and load will descend
properly. Remove clevis by removing the cotter pin and clevis pin.
Remove retaining ring, the three screws, and plates with screws.
